+  GNU Linux-libre is a Free version of the kernel Linux (see below),\
+  suitable for use with the GNU Operating System in 100% Free\
+  GNU/Linux-libre System Distributions.\
+  http://www.gnu.org/distros/\
+\
+  It removes non-Free components from Linux, that are disguised as\
+  source code or distributed in separate files.  It also disables\
+  run-time requests for non-Free components, shipped separately or as\
+  part of Linux, and documentation pointing to them, so as to avoid\
+  (Free-)baiting users into the trap of non-Free Software.\
+  http://www.fsfla.org/anuncio/2010-11-Linux-2.6.36-libre-debait\
+\
+  Linux-libre started within the gNewSense GNU/Linux distribution.\
+  It was later adopted by Jeff Moe, who coined its name, and in 2008\
+  it became a project maintained by FSF Latin America.  In 2012, it\
+  became part of the GNU Project.\
+\
+  The GNU Linux-libre project takes a minimal-changes approach to\
+  cleaning up Linux, making no effort to substitute components that\
+  need to be removed with functionally equivalent Free ones.\
+  Nevertheless, we encourage and support efforts towards doing so.\
+  http://libreplanet.org/wiki/LinuxLibre:Devices_that_require_non-free_firmware\
+\
+  Our mascot is Freedo, a light-blue penguin that has just come out\
+  of the shower.  Although we like penguins, GNU is a much greater\
+  contribution to the entire system, so its mascot deserves more\
+  promotion.  See our web page for their images.\
